 Britain's Federation of the Electronics Industry has posted a page on the embedded chip problem. It's a comprehensive list.

WHAT TYPES OF FAILURE CAN OCCUR: 
 
Maintenance interval of obsolescence errors 
 
Logic errors (minus quantities) 
 
Unpredictable results of data manipulation 
 
Total equipment failure 
 
These systems do not always fail-safe
